Eknath Kisan Kumbharkar vs The State Of Maharashtra

Judgment text excerpt

The Supreme Court upheld the death sentence awarded to the appellant for the murder of his pregnant daughter under Section 302 IPC, while also convicting him under Section 316 IPC for causing the death of an unborn child and Section 364 IPC for kidnapping. The Court emphasized the heinous nature of the crime, noting the premeditated act of strangulation and the appellant's attempt to mislead the victim's family. The appeal against the High Court's confirmation of the death sentence was dismissed, affirming the lower court's findings and the severity of the punishment.
